I bought DF one from eBay. It's quite a few years ago now, so I don't have the seller details. It came from Ecuador (in its own balsa wood box!) and you could customise it - make the brim larger etc, and pick your own band (plus a spare). It cost about £40 all in, and my dad absolutely loves it and wears it at every opportunity.

I'm sure there will still be sellers offering this service on eBay now, so worth looking.
